Job Description
Position Objective: Provide services as a Scientific Technical Writer in support of the overall functions of the National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ases (NIAID) within the National Institutes of Health (NIH). The NIAID Policy, Planning and Evaluation Branch requires expertise to complement the efforts of current federal employees. The PPE Branch seeks technical expertise to translate advanced biological concepts into clear guidance. A contract science writer ensures timely, objective, and high-quality development of technical documents that are essential for compliance with the Executive Order on Improving the Safet and Security of biological Research, addressing emerging biosafety and biosecurity risks, and facilitating effective information sharing across NIAID, NIH Institutes, and Federal agencies.
Duties And Responsibilities
- Prepares scientific and technical materials for publication.
- Research, write and edit in accordance with industry, academic and publication standards book manuscripts and chapters, peer reviewed journal articles, conference and symposium proceedings and general print media articles.
- Research, write and edit scientific and technical information in a variety of formats, including articles, blog posts, factsheets, one-pagers, brochures, presentations and speeches, workshop summaries, reports, briefing materials, press releases, content for digital media in online and print format.
- Research, write and edit policy papers featuring recommendations based on original research findings and conclusions.
- Conducts advanced literature reviews and prepares reports, summaries and presentations on findings.
- Perform literature reviews of scientific and technical literature to identify
- methodologies, findings and conclusions of significance and prepare summaries and reports for distribution among research and medical staff.
- Maintain credentials to standard databases, repositories, libraries, and search engines to ensure access to the most recent domestic and international publications, dissertations, research reports, etc.
- Prepare summaries, reports, dashboards and presentations on results of literature reviews to researchers and staff.
- Creates and maintains databases of all research materials, literature reviews, and publications.
- Assist data managers collect, collate, organize and upload information to advanced data repositories, and integrate local databases with enterprise software and applications such as REPORTER and IMPACII.
- Develop literature and publication repository using standard software applications and tools of research materials and conduct queries.
- Develops and edits official program management reports, official correspondence and audit reports.
- Coordinate with senior executives to prepare outline and collect and assemble into annual reports.
- Review and provide comment on the scientific and technical accuracy of a variety of reports, presentations and correspondence.
- Review and provide edits to a variety of external communication and informational materials to ensure scientific and technical accuracy and completeness.
- Provide scientific and technical writing expertise to assist researchers and staff prepare documentation.
- Assist researchers develop scientific and technical documentation, providing insights, guidance and recommendations to improve products.
- Design and maintain templates and detailed usage instructions for preparing common documentation, such as posters, presentations, reports, proposals, abstracts, etc.
- Finalizes documents and prepares materials for publication.
- Proofread all documents (drafts and final forms) for scientific and technical accuracy and completeness prior to submitting them for review and approval or acceptance.
- Critically review draft documents, synthesize comments, and incorporate appropriate comments from other reviewers into successive drafts to prepare final documents.
- Provides expert guidance, direction and support to executives in the development and distribution of scientific and technical written materials.
- Provide expert advice for general health and science communications activities that involve content creation for health communication and outreach projects, scientific and technical publication, promotional materials and online events.
- Provide expert advice and consultation to staff on issues related to scientific and programmatic written articles.
- Advise executives and program managers on written materials to be developed and present strategies for maximizing impact and performance toward organizational and programmatic goas and objectives.
- Mentors, coaches and trains writers, editors and staff on scientific and technical writing and editing practices and procedures.
- Researchers, repackages and shares among research and operational staff best practices, tips, and practices for improving the quality and consistency of scientific and technical writing.
